Output 1991ca076a4c6b42eb48bf6060561cc59ecd388a683a1561813760bed07387aa:29

value
170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 370c00b81d1f6d20240942bd361bbf5897c70485 OP_EQUALVERIFY OP_CHECKSIG
address
1624YXBvLc24Jrrfx6Yw7avfPPbuDjsf9G
transaction
1991ca076a4c6b42eb48bf6060561cc59ecd388a683a1561813760bed07387aa
confirmations
201494
spent
true